Platform’s year-end report offers a glimpse into this year’s most favourite video content
As 2024 is around the corner, short-video platform TikTok scrolls back the year’s most popular videos among users in Pakistan in its annual year-end report.
Focused on the most-favourite video content from this year, the platform takes a look at what kept its users glued to the app, spending their time enjoying some local and international content.
“In 2023, trending content took over For You feeds around the world — especially in the entertainment, lifestyle, education, and sports categories,” TikTok mentioned in its report.
Owing to its craze for cricket, Pakistanis made sure that a video of national team’s pacer Haris Rauf and Indian star batter Virat Kohli meeting during the World Cup was one of the most popular on the app.

Shared by the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B), the video made it to users’ favourite this year.
The report added that users were mesmerized by funny skits by creator and actor Momin Saqib, delicious recipes by Chef Samiullah, and beauty looks by actor Syeda Tuba Anwar for her shows — all of which remained in everyone’s “fav lists”.

While Saqib is known for his funny, sarcastic content, his video featuring Indian actor Jaqueline Fernandez during the Asia Cup tour was among the most popular content lists on the app.

Another popular video was that of Pakistani actor Tuba’s new looks, as she appeared in dramas on television screens. Tuba is known for her versatile roles in local dramas.
Chef Saimullah left his viewers and followers on the video platform amused with delish recipes, but his most viewed and hot favourite among them was his video of Qeema Kachoori for Ramazan.

Adeel Chaudry, a self-proclaimed food connoisseur, and chef, won his followers’ hearts by sharing the recipe of a prophetic beverage, a favourite of Prophet Muhammad (PBUH).
“@adeelchaudry1: Adeel Chaudry shares the recipe for the favorite drink of Prophet Muhammad PBUH and Sunnat e Nabwi, the ‘Nabeez’ a detox drink,” TikTok mentioned in its report.
